Wear Mechanisms of Al_2O_3/TiC Ceramic CuttingTools in Machining of G4335V
Zhang Jinsheng et al
The machining performance and wear mechanism of the Al2O3/TiC ceramic cutting tool in continuous turning of G4335V high strength steel were examined. Resultsshowed that at lower cutting speed, the flank wear resistance of the Al2O3/TiC tool was almost the same as the cemented carbide tool (YT15), while at high cutting speed, the Al2O3/TiC tool exhibited much more improved flank wear resistance compared to cemented carbide tool.Adhesion and abrasion wear were found to be tile diminant wear mechanism.
